Size of tire

Although the cost of a tire and its installation can be high, the average tire cost is less than $70. However, the price will depend on the type of tire you choose, the manufacturer, and location. Installation costs in New York City average $40. In less-populated areas, it will cost $15-20 per tire. Compare prices to determine the best price.


Prices for tires and installation vary depending on the size of your vehicle, brand, style and installation. A set of four full-size tires for a pickup truck can cost from $400 to $1800.
